Dec. 2011 Sets Record For The Highest-Ever Volume Of Global Trade And Global Output In History Posted: 23 Feb 2012 05:01 PM PST The CPB Netherlands Bureau for Economic Policy Analysis released its monthly report this week on world trade and world industrial production for the month of December 2011. Here are some of the highlights: 1. World trade volume increased in December by 1.5% on a monthly basis and by 2.5% on an annual basis, bringing the global trade index to a new all-time record high of 166.6 (see chart). Posted: 23 Feb 2012 02:30 PM PST Sears Holdings Corporation (NASDAQ:SHLD) reported fourth-quarter 2011 adjusted earnings of 54 cents per share, well below the Zacks Consensus Estimate of 68 cents per share. The earnings per share declined drastically from the prior-year quarter earnings of $3.67 per share. The drop in the company's quarterly performance was primarily due to the sluggish top-line performance and decreased margins. |

Chart Of The Day: Oil Vs. Gasoline Prices Posted: 23 Feb 2012 02:29 PM PST The chart above from GasBuddy shows retail gas prices and crude oil prices over the last three months. Gas prices have increased by about 7.5% since November from $3.34 to $3.59 per gallon, while crude oil prices have increased by about 9%, from $97.25 to about $106 per barrel over the same period. Posted: 23 Feb 2012 02:00 PM PST GlaxoSmithKline (NYSE:GSK) recently announced that its candidate, Nimenrix (MenACWY-TT), received a positive opinion from the European Medicines Agency's ("EMA") Committee for Medicinal Products for Human Use ("CHMP"). The CHMP recommended the approval of Nimenrix for active immunisation against invasive meningococcal disease caused by Neisseria meningitidis serogroups A, C, W-135 and Y. |
Posted: 23 Feb 2012 02:00 PM PST Advance Auto Parts Inc. (NYSE:AAP) reported a 58% rise in profit to 90 cents per share in the fourth quarter fiscal 2011 ended December 31, 2011 from 57 cents in the comparable quarter ended January 1, 2011. The profit exceeded the Zacks Consensus Estimate by a considerable margin of 16 cents per share. The increase in profit was driven by the company's aggressive store expansion strategy, enabling better availability of parts to its customers. |

Shell Eyes East Africa With Cove Bid Posted: 23 Feb 2012 01:40 PM PST Royal Dutch Shell Plc (RDS.A) has proposed a $1.6 billion (£992.4 million) bid to acquire U.K.-listed Africa-focused oil explorer Cove Energy Plc. Should the deal go through, it will open up a new gas frontier for the Anglo-Dutch company in Kenya and Mozambique, the latter of which has already emerged as a major center for liquefied natural gas (LNG) projects. |

Posted: 23 Feb 2012 12:15 PM PST Before the bell, Ameren Corporation (NYSE:AEE) reported its fourth quarter and fiscal 2011 results. In the reported quarter, the company with core earnings of 14 cents a share missed the Zacks Consensus Estimate of 15 cents by a penny. The company's results also came way below the year-ago quarterly earnings of 22 cents. Performance in the reported quarter was affected by warmer winter temperatures as well as a scheduled nuclear refueling and maintenance outage at the Callaway Energy Center. |
